Learn how to Automate Your Cooking
Fellow WIRED reviewer Matthew Korfhage is presently testing two completely different robots that may prepare dinner your dishes for you, however within the meantime, the closest I’ve discovered is the 10-in-1 Ninja Foodi PossibleCooker Professional ($119). You may select from choices starting from sear and gradual prepare dinner to sous vide and even bake. It turned my broccoli-cheddar soup experiment (I used to be on a quest to duplicate my favourite Panera soup for Soupgiving) right into a one-pot dish the place I may sauté my onions, fire up my béchamel, after which combine in all my substances and let it simmer till accomplished. It even comes with an built-in utensil.
It was actually useful to make use of in an already busy kitchen, and I think about it will be indispensable for large, Thanksgiving-style dinners the place the range and oven are monopolized. Whereas I nonetheless needed to do the cooking, I used to be in a position to hang around in my very own little spot and let the PossibleCooker assist me. It has a timer within the entrance to assist remind me how lengthy I have been cooking on a setting, although I do want there have been a medium setting (your decisions are high and low for the cooktop settings).
Automate Your Meals Disposal
There are a number of meals scraps once you’re cooking for occasions like Thanksgiving and vacation dinner events. I actually cherished grabbing the canister from the FoodCycler and bringing it subsequent to the place we have been cooking soups so everybody may throw their meals scraps in as we went. When it is full, simply set it within the machine and it’ll grind-and-dry the scraps (or leftovers!) right into a form of nutrient-rich meal that may be blended in with potting soil or sprinkled in your garden. I’ve the brand new FoodCycler Eco 5, and WIRED reviewer Kat Merck recommends the FoodCycler Eco 3 as considered one of her favourite residence meals recyclers.
